You know, I don't just blog about food and eateries. I much rather write about the people behind a successful brand. So today, I'm featuring the face behind this cafe, CHAIWALLA & CO.

The driving force behind this successful small-medium business is a Mr Nazrul Hakim, a young lad still in his early thirties. Suprisingly he has no prior experience in the F&B world. He, in fact worked in the shipping industry for more than a decade and climbed the corporate ladder until finally he earned his Masters!

So why opened a cafe, you asked? Well, this business plan was embedded in his mind long long time ago, when he was still an employee. While his friends and colleagues would spend money on luxuries, he saved his own with the vision that he will use this as an investment to open his own business. Fast forward many years later, he felt the time was right to implement his dream and tadaaaa, CHAIWALLA & CO. was born!

MEANING OF CHAIWALLA:

Chai means tea in hindi.
Walla means someones who serves.




UNIQUENESS:

The look of this cafe is so simple yet compelling. 2 containers stacked on top of the other, the upper one used as storage and the lower one serves as a cafe counter. They are, in fact, the first in Malaysia to implement the container cafe idea! The industrial look is both mod and rad! So original, so creative, I love, love, love their concept!

FOOD:

CW & Co serves a variety of drinks and pastry. So before you order, you might want to look at the menu at the counter. Too confusing! What do I order? Aha, lemme guide you step by step;

* Choose a BASE - Tea, Milk tea, Coffee, Fresh Milk, Smoothies.

* Choose a FLAVOUR - Caramel, Pure Honey, Saffron Rose, Double Choco, Winter Melon,                                                      Strawberry, Apple, Japanese Matcha, Banana, Vanilla, Mango,                                                              Passionfruit, Pure yogurt, Ice cream, Lemon!

* Choose a TOPPING - Pearls, Grass Jelly, Pudding, Coffee Jelly, Yogurt Pops, Basil Seeds, Nata de                                        coco AND my favourite, PINK POPS!

VISION & CULTURE:

The vision of Chaiwalla & Co is that they want a brand that engage with the community, the subculture and serves as a platform for fashion, arts & music. And they, as a young company, also aims to educate and empower the young people and aspiring entrepeneurs out there! <1000 rounds of applause!!>

What impress me most is that Chaiwalla is shorlisted as one of the top 20 finalists, out of hundreds of submissions, for the Alliance Bank SME Innovation Challenge! What an achievement for a 2 year old brand! True to the intention of the owner, he hopes his success will be an inspiration to the Malay/Muslim community to further involved themselves into the world of business. Kudos to you & your team!!
